       The importance of boiler level gauge water level measurement is well known. However, there are many unrecoverable defects in the balanced container type (differential pressure) measurement method used for continuous measurement of boiler drum water level, which is mainly reflected in the following several aspects:

1. It is not possible to carry out full working condition measurement, there is a “false water level” measurement, and it takes a long time to establish a stable differential pressure condition under unstable operating conditions such as boiler start, stop, emptying, continuous row, accident, etc., or a long recovery time. It is impossible to establish normal differential pressure and require manual intervention.

2. Under the stable operating conditions, due to structural constraints, the compensation for system measurement errors caused by the temperature at the water side cannot be completely resolved. Under the conditions of accidents such as boiler shortage and full water, excessive system measurement error may bring serious consequences.

3. The structure is complex, there are many static seal points, the construction scale is large and there is a problem of winter insulation.

4, the measurement time lag is long, can not immediately respond to changes in the boiler water level, measurement signal quality is poor.

5, due to the existence of condensation tube heat, the use of high cost.

These defects are due to the differential pressure measurement principle and its unreasonable sampling structure, and cannot be improved. Under normal operating conditions, it has caused great dangers for the safe operation of boilers.
